Minor League Catching Coordinator: Operational Breakdown & Roving Duties

Field Curriculum Matrix

The Padres roving catching coordinator travels constantly across all five affiliates, spending 4–7 day stints per club to standardize receiving technique, implement pitch-framing technology, and mentor young bilingual catchers.

Pitch-Framing & One-Knee Stances

Teaching low-target presentation and rotational flexibility to optimize strike presentation at bottom of zone with automated ball-strike (ABS) and traditional umpires.

Standardization across AA/AAA

Pop-Time & Footwork Optimization

Drills to shave split-seconds off exchange times; targeting sub-1.95s throw times to second base utilizing high-speed video feedback and radar guns.

Benchmarked at Single-A / Peoria

PitchCom & Game-Calling Protocol

Managing PitchCom electronic transmitter setups, advanced scouting report synthesis, pitch design synergy with arms, and in-game adjustments.

Daily Bullpen Prep • All Tiers

Bilingual Bullpen Leadership

Bridging communication between international pitching prospects and English/Spanish-speaking battery mates; fostering confidence behind the plate.

Cultural & Communication Link
